This coming Friday, Aug 1st, in place of our normal morning volunteer workday, we will make a visit to check out each of the TOBM Monarch Waystation sites, beginning with the naturalized meadow slope at Lake Tomohawk (below Black Mountain Pool). There are 4 Monarch Waystation sites, from which we typically rotate weekly during our volunteer hours. For the tour, we will carpool/caravan to each. You are then welcome to join us to visit two other Monarch Waystation sites in Swannanoa, in the Souverigin Oaks community near Warren Wilson College, finishing up the tour by around 11:30am.
Mid summer is a time when native pollinator gardens are teaming with bird life and pollinators. Come check them out with Emily Sampson, who created and has been maintaining these spaces since 2015.
